I am looking at booking flights on points in Business/First from CUR-MIA-BOS, if relevant I am EP, as this is an international itinerary in business/first would it be reasonable to expect to get lounge access included in MIA? The main reason is we're looking at an (intentional) six hour layover as one member of our party will be heading off elsewhere as a UM from Miami so we need to allow enough time to facilitate that.
From what I've experienced flying international/business gets you in the lounge, just not sure of that holds true for shorter business trips on points.
Sorry, no access based on a Business Class ticket between CUR and the U.S. Flights between the Caribbean and the U.S. are not qualifying international flights for Admirals Club access.
